Real Madrid prepares Bombshell Report for FIFA Amidst Referee Scandal

Madrid, Spain – The storm surrounding the “Negreira case” in spanish football is far from over, and Real Madrid is reportedly preparing to take the fight to the highest international level. Sources close to the club indicate that Los Blancos are in the final stages of compiling a complete report detailing alleged refereeing injustices over nearly two decades,a document they intend to submit directly to FIFA.

The bombshell news was revealed by prominent Spanish sports journalist Josep Pedrerol, who stated that Real Madrid has been meticulously gathering evidence for an extended period. This report aims to meticulously document what the club perceives as a systemic bias in Spanish refereeing during the tenure of José María Enríquez Negreira as vice president of the Technical Committee of referees (CTA).

Pedrerol elaborated on the scope of the report, explaining that it extends beyond Negreira’s direct involvement. Real Madrid has added subsequent years in which Negreira, even without being there, the group has maintained people who were already there at that time and therefore the system had not changed, improved, varied, he stated. This suggests a belief within the club that the alleged issues persisted even after Negreira’s official role concluded.

The implications of this report, if substantiated, could be enormous for Spanish football and perhaps for FIFA itself. The club’s intention is to present a case of meaningful damage inflicted upon Real Madrid over more than 20 years of La Liga competition.

That report is almost finished. Infantino, president of FIFA, knows that it will reach him very soon, Pedrerol continued, emphasizing the urgency and the direct channel to FIFA President Gianni Infantino. The report is said to be packed with videos, all kinds of documentation to bolster their claims.

What does this mean for Real Madrid and Spanish football?

If FIFA deems the report credible, it could trigger a significant inquiry into the Spanish Football Federation (RFEF) and the CTA. This could lead to sanctions, reputational damage, and potentially even a re-evaluation of past results, though the latter is highly unlikely given the passage of time.

For Real Madrid, this is a bold strategic move.by bypassing domestic channels and going directly to FIFA, they are signaling a lack of faith in the Spanish football authorities to address the issue adequately. It’s a high-stakes gamble that could either vindicate their long-held suspicions or backfire spectacularly.
